Haitian Gourde & Ghanaian Cedi Currency Information

HTG
Haitian Gourde
FACT 1: The currency of Haiti is the Haitian Gourde. It's code is HTG and & the symbol is G. According to our data, USD to HTG is the most popular Gourde exchange rate conversion.
FACT 2: The most frequently used banknotes in Haiti are: G10, G25, G50, G100, G250, G500, G1000. It's used solely in Haiti.
FACT 3: The Haitian Gourde was first introduced in 1813 replacing the Pound; it has since been revalued three times. A 1000 Gourdes note was introduced in 1999, to commemorate the 250th anniversary of Port-au-Prince.
GHS
Ghanaian Cedi
FACT 1: The currency of Ghana is the Ghananian Cedi. It's code is GHS & its symbol is GH¢. According to our data, USD to GHS is the most popular Cedi exchange rate conversion.
FACT 2: The most frequently used banknotes in Ghana are: GH¢5, GH¢10, GH¢20, GH¢50. It's used in Ghana.
FACT 3: The Ghanaian New Cedi was introduced in 2007 and was the highest-valued currency unit issued by sovereign countries in Africa in 2007.
